Los Angeles label Sanctuary has debuted its first-ever store.

The 30-year-old fashion brand's 2,000-square-foot flagship is now open on Beverly Drive and features its latest women's ready-to-wear, footwear, and accessories alongside exclusive capsules and a curated selection of upcycled vintage pieces.

On the racks, find Sanctuary's California-cool spring 2026 womenswear collection, Smart Creation line of pieces made from recycled and low-impact materials, and more, such as bubble T-shirt dresses made from organic cotton, lightweight button-downs and floral-printed jackets and shorts made from sustainable linen, light blue lace-trimmed slip skirts, ivory satin track jackets and pants, and (of course) effortless denim in barrel, wide leg, utility, and slim straight silhouettes.

Designed in collaboration with renowned global firm Valerio Architects (which has worked with Bulgari, Golden Goose, and Brunello Cucinelli), the store was guided by Feng Shui principles of creating balance and "chi" – or energy flow – as seen in sleek architectural curves inspired by the flow of water, wood fixtures juxtaposed with stuccoed blocks, and brushed brass hardware against sun-washed stone.

Sanctuary's new boutique also houses a sculptural art installation – titled "Love & Hero" – by costume designer Sam Adair, whose statement-making pieces have been worn by Billie Eilish, Lizzo, Christina Aguilera, and others.

Founded in 1997 by married duo Ken and Debra Polanco, Sanctuary became known for its pants before expanding into ready-to-wear, swimwear, shoes, and accessories. Though the brand is stocked at Nordstrom, Revolve, Bloomingdale's, and Anthropologie (to name just a few), Sanctuary's L.A. flagship gives it the freedom to showcase its collections in a space of its own design codes.

"Opening our first retail location is very personal to me," Sanctuary co-founder and CEO Ken Polanco says in a statement. "This store allows us to connect directly with our community, tell our story in a physical space, and bring our vision to life in a way that digital alone never could."

The label celebrated its first brick-and-mortar with a starry grand opening party on Thursday, Feb. 26, with guests such as celebrity aesthetician Shani Darden, celebrity stylist Allison Bornstein, environmental activist Leah Thomas, and model Rocky Barnes (who all star in the label's spring 2026 campaign), as well as singer Katharine McPhee Foster, dancer and former The Talk host Amanda Kloots, actress Kayla Ewell and others. The fete kicked off with a ribbon-cutting ceremony led by Beverly Hills Mayor, Dr. Sharona Nazarian, and Beverly Hills Chamber President and CEO Todd Johnson. Partygoers enjoyed decadent bites from L.A.'s AndSons Chocolates and ROE Caviar while DJ Dana Boulos provided beats.
